Remember Fresh Food?


Have you ever eaten food that was harvested the same day? or picked vegetables from your home garden, prepared and ate them? If so....you know how much difference "Fresh" makes. A few new restauranters have taken this "Field to Table" concept to the benefit of the lucky diners that find their restaurants. After a glowing recommendation from a fellow wine and food lover, I made a reservation at Amani's in Downingtown. I have to admitt that the falling snow, and freezing temperatures preculded Chef Jonathan Amann and Sous Chef, Michael Derham, from serving local produce, he did manage freshly prepared local beef and pork. The meat was sourced from a local farm in Honeybrook. Our meal was beautifully prepared, proptly served with attentive, informative service. Chef Jon's wife, Jeanine, manages the restaurant and has converted the facility to welcoming, comfortable venue. Amani's features an open kitchen. Diners are able to watch their food being prepared and even speak with the chef. The Amann's have taken their BYO to a new level by offering mixers, glassware and ingredients for cocktails. This is a welcome addition to diners who prefer a Martini or Cosmo before dinner. After dinner, Carol and I met Jon and Jeanine, and suggested we team up to offer a wine pairing dinner.
